CVE-2024-39645
The Tutor LMS plugin for WordPress versions up to 2.7.2 contains a Cross-Site Request Forgery vulnerability resulting from inadequate nonce verification in multiple functions. An unauthenticated attacker could exploit this flaw to remove courses by crafting a malicious request, provided an administrator can be socially engineered into clicking a link. The vulnerability affects all versions prior to 2.7.3.
